SjB
f644b9a07a registering a weak_mods when using register_code16
Scenario:
Locking the KC_LSHIFT, and then using a tap dance key that registers a
S(KC_9) will unregister the KC_LSHIFT.

The tap dance or any keycode that is registered should not have the
side effect of cancelling a locked moditifier. We should be using a
similar logic as the TMK codes in tmk_core/comman/action.c:158.

SjB
2b3859937b speeding up (un)register_code16
In register_code16 and unregister_code16 we call register_code and
unregister_code twice, once for the mods and once for the keycode.
The (un)register_code have many check to see that keycode we have sent
however because we know that we are sending it a mods key, why not
just skip all of it and call (un)register_mods instead. This will skip
alot of checks and should speedup the loop a little.

SjB
6f44ca7a59 oneshot timeout would only timeout after an event.
After setting a ONESHOT_TIMEOUT value, the oneshot layer state would
not expire without an event being triggered (key pressed). The reason
was that in the process_record function we would return priort to
execute the process_action function if it detected a NOEVENT cycle. The
process_action contained the codes to timeout the oneshot layer state.
The codes to clear the oneshot layer state have been move just in
front of where we check for the NOEVENT cycle in the process_record
function.
